Which of the following equations is equivalent to 36 – 2 = 34?
34 + 2 = 36
34 ∙ 2 = 36
34 – 2 = 36
36 + 34 = 2

Respuesta :

eusuntclaudia eusuntclaudia
  • 12-09-2021

Answer: 34 + 2 = 36

Step-by-step explanation:

36 - 2 = 34

Add 2 to this:

36 - 2 + 2 = 34 + 2

36 = 34 + 2
